As we celebrate #PrideMonth, let's talk about how different types of therapy can help the LGBTQ+ community. For those who may want more than the traditional talk therapy, #somatictherapy is an alternative option, as it uses the mind-body connection to help individuals in their journey of healing, whether they're processing trauma or discovering more about themselves and their identity. LGBTQ+ individuals, who often experience disconnection from their bodies due to societal pressures, past traumas, or dysmorphia, find somatic therapy: - Provides a safe, affirming environment - Helps them develop trust within their bodies - Allows them to explore their unique identities - Fosters self-acceptance, self-love, and a sense of belonging

June is Pride Month, a time to celebrate the LGBTQ+ community and recognize the ongoing struggle for equality and acceptance. As a psychology student, I understand the profound impact that social acceptance and mental health support can have on individuals' well-being. Pride Month is not just about celebrating identities; it is also a call to action to address the mental health challenges faced by the LGBTQ+ community. Studies show that LGBTQ+ individuals are at a higher risk for mental health issues due to stigma, discrimination, and lack of support. As future psychologists, it is crucial for us to advocate for inclusive practices and create safe spaces where everyone can thrive. This month, let's commit to learning more about the unique experiences and needs of the LGBTQ+ community. Let's use our knowledge to foster acceptance, provide compassionate care, and promote mental wellness for all. 🌈Did you know that many in the LGBTQ+ community face unique challenges in legacy planning? 🌈 Your rights and wishes may not always be automatically recognized, putting you at risk of having your true intentions overlooked. Without a proper estate plan, your assets, medical decisions, and even your personal dignity could end up controlled by laws that don't recognize your relationships or respect your identity. Estate planning ensures that your partner, friends, and chosen family are recognized and protected. We understand the nuances of LGBTQ+ estate planning.
